| Ingredient | Amount | Notes |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Instant oatmeal | 50g (adjust to your container, it's flexible) | ||
| Banana | Half (about 100g) | ||
| Cocoa powder | A pinch (a few grams will do) | ||
| Milk | About 100ml or a bit more |

Slice or break the banana and place it on top. Slice if you want it to look nice; I’m too lazy to slice, breaking it is faster.
Pour in the milk — as much as you’d like to drink, just don’t overflow. (Other recipes suggest coconut milk works too!)

Microwave on high for 1 minute. The oats should come out soft and creamy like in the photo. (The original recipe called for 2 minutes, but mine turned out too hard — 1 minute is just right.) Enjoy your quick and healthy breakfast! 😋🥳
